Avengers Infinity War and Endgame are really one very long story that was split into two parts for practical reasons. The live action filming for both was done together. But they needed so much special effects/CGI work they had to split the releases a year apart. The other reason is the combined run time is 5.5 hours, which is too long for a theater audience, and the theaters could not get enough showings per day. The split in the story is at the low point, where it looks like the bad guys have won and there is no hope. Hope returns in part 2 because of the most important mouse in the universe, but it is still an emotional roller coaster. The theater audience had to wait a year to see the end of the story. Today you can watch both parts as fast as you want. Having multiple infinity stones means you can use all of their powers individually or combined. Even Thanos is not powerful enough to handle multiple stones without the golden gauntlet. It protects his body somewhat and lets him use combinations, like pressing multiple piano keys to make a chord. Thanos isn't the most powerful being individually. The Celestials are more powerful. But he has huge ships and many followers. He calls his followers, and the stolen children like Nebula and Gamora, the "Children of Thanos". He's basically the leader of a death cult, because he wants to kill half the life in the Universe. He's named after the Greek god Thanatos, the personification of death.
